Understanding the Sofa Sale Market

Sofa sales take place throughout the year, but they tend to peak throughout specific times-- typically throughout vacation weekends, end-of-season events, and clearance durations. Retailers typically discount sofas to make way for brand-new designs or throughout significant shopping events like Black Friday, Valentine's Day, Memorial Day, and Labor Day.

Key Factors Influencing Sofa Sales:

  1. Seasonal Trends: Furniture sellers normally align their sales with seasonal choices. For instance, lighter materials might go on sale in late winter season, clearing space for heavier fabrics appropriate for colder months.
  2. New Arrivals: When brand-new stock gets here, retailers often launch sales on the previous year's designs to make room.
  3. Clearance Events: Stores may hold clearance sales to lower stock before renovations or shop movings.

Kinds of Sofas on Sale

When searching for a sofa, understanding the different types available can assist a purchaser make an informed choice. Each style has distinct qualities, which can influence both comfort and visual appeal.

Common Sofa Styles:

  • Sectional Sofas: These pieces are flexible and can be organized in numerous configurations to fit various room designs.
  • Sleeper Sofas: Ideal for small areas, these sofas can transform into beds for guests.
  • Chesterfield Sofas: Known for their deep button tufting and rolled arms, they include a touch of beauty to standard settings.
  • Mid-Century Modern Sofas: These sofas reflect the minimalist patterns of the mid-20th century with clean lines and easy forms.
  • Budget plan Sofas: Generally, these are made from cheaper materials however can still offer a trendy look and convenience for transient living areas.

Tips for Scoring the very best Deals

Before You Shop: Research and Planning

  • Know Your Budget: Determine how much you want to invest. This can help you limit your choices quickly.
  • Procedure Your Space: Before heading out, determine the area where the sofa will sit. Don't forget to account for entrances and elevators!

During the Sale: Smart Shopping Strategies

  1. Sign Up for Newsletters: Many furniture stores use exclusive discounts to their customers.
  2. Shop Early: Arriving early throughout sales can provide you initially dibs on popular products before they sell out.
  3. Take a look at the Quality: Check materials and construction; choose for sofas with tough frames and high-density foam for durability.
  4. Work out: In lots of cases, there is room for negotiation. Do not hesitate to request additional discounts or complimentary delivery.

After Your Purchase: Delivery and Care

  • Inspect upon Delivery: Ensure that the sofa has not been harmed during transportation.
  • Read Care Instructions: Different fabrics need various care techniques. Familiarize yourself with how to keep your sofa's appearance and durability.

Frequently Asked Questions About Sofa Sales

1. When is the very best time to purchase a sofa?

The very best times to buy a sofa include significant holidays (such as Labor Day, Memorial Day, and Black Friday) and the end of the winter when merchants clear out stock.

2. How can I tell if a sofa is the right size for my room?

Usage painter's tape to detail the dimensions of the sofa on your floor. This will assist visualize just how much space the sofa will occupy.

3. What is the average lifespan of a sofa?

A sound sofa can last anywhere from 7 to 15 years, depending on the quality of products, use, and care.

4. Exist guarantees on sofas purchased throughout sales?

The majority of sellers use service warranties no matter sale status. Make sure to ask about service warranty information before acquiring.

5. Can I return a sofa if it does not fit in my area?

Return policies vary by merchant. Always examine the store's return policies before acquiring, especially with larger furniture items like sofas.
